Electronic artist Christian Löffler is releasing his new album ‘Parallels’ in February, and ahead of the launch label Deutsche Grammophon has created a web app for people to remix some of its music. Specifically one track, ‘Moldau’, with a set of sliders to turn up and down its bass drum, bassline, synth pads and other elements.
When they’ve created something they like, they can save and share the results – a #parallelsrework hashtag will gather together these fan creations on social media, with Löffler promising to share some of his favourites via his channels. “I think it’s quite an intuitive and easy process that allows combining centuries-old orchestral recordings as well as my own electronic textures into new, unique arrangements,” he said.
